New leisure centre for Bexhill?

A new multi-million pound sports centre could be built in Bexhill, East Sussex, after Rother District Council (RDC) agreed to appoint consultants to conduct a feasibility study into the plans.

The new centre, which is to be situated on the town's Down site and could cost up to £18m, will form part of the council's scheme to consolidate the town's two existing leisure facilities into one single site by 2016. Included in the proposals for the new centre is a four-court sports hall, a two-court ancillary hall, a soft play area and a 25m, six-lane swimming pool, as well as a leisure pool, a climbing wall and a 100-station fitness suite.

A health suite, changing areas, a bar, a café and a social area are also earmarked as part of the project, as is an outdoor multi-use games area and a ten-lane ten-pin bowling facility. S&P Architects has already been involved in developing initial plans for a combined wet and dry leisure facility, with two options identified at an anticipated cost of £14m and £18m respectively.

The proposed Bexhill Down site for the new centre is currently occupied by Bexhill High School, which the principle landowner, East Sussex County Council (ESCC), plans to relocate to another site in the town by 2010. However, ESCC is yet to decide whether a Vocational Skills Centre at the Down site is to remain, while RDC will also need to acquire land from the Ministry of Defence, which owns the nearby drill hall.

A council report revealed that the main source of funding for the scheme is likely to come from the relocation of the town's leisure pool at the Ravenside Retail Park if planning restrictions are removed, but it was revealed that RDC would otherwise be unable to fund the project itself. The report also said: "Initial consultation with the Amateur Swimming Association has confirmed that no capital funding is available from the association. It is also unlikely that any major capital funding will be available from Lottery sources until after the conclusion of the London Olympic Games in 2012."
